North Haven, CT—-Engaged as the construction manager by Yale-New Haven Hospital, O&G was hired to manage the remodeling of an existing four-story office building to create a comprehensive ambulatory care center.

With tight budget and a total construction duration of less than six months, O&G’s field team, led by project manager Carrie Riera and superintendents George Parenteau and Steve Baranello, successfully managed this fast-track project; opening the North Haven Medical Center on time.

Designed by Cannon Design, the medical center includes Yale-New Haven’s first interventional immunology center specializing in the treatment of chronic autoimmune conditions and related disorders.

The new building also includes a walk-in/primary care center, a Smilow Cancer Hospital Care Center – one of ten Smilow Hospital Care Centers in Connecticut, consultative and infusion treatment services for outpatient medical and hematological care, and an on-site diagnostic radiology center offering MRI and digital X-Ray imaging, fluoroscopy, laboratory and blood drawing services.

Office renovation of the third and fourth floors, approximately 50,000sf, was completed in less than eight weeks, consolidating Yale-New Haven Hospital’s IT Department from multiple sites in New Haven to the North Haven facility and moving them in on schedule.

The concept of using a non-purpose built office building for a state-of-the-art clinical facility was chosen for speed to market and O&G’s pre-construction and field teams rose to the challenge. It was only through the development of a strong rapport, regular meetings and constant communication with Yale-New Haven Hospital, Cannon Design and the local Building Officials that any issues were resolved in a timely manner. Throughout, a close working relationship with the entire team was essential to overall project success.

A key to the success of this ambitious project was the use of the BIM Model, simulating the coordination and layout of building components. O&G’s superintendents used our BIM360 Field iPad software to assure excellence in quality of buildings systems and installations, allowing near instant communication of any field issues to the design team. Made up of some of the company’s most dedicated and experienced employees, O&G continually met the Owner’s expectations, delivering the North Haven Medical Center on-time, ready to open.
